Lionsgate Premarket Jump on Michael Biopic's Record Opening

Lionsgate Studios Corp (NYSE: LION) rose about 9.36% in Monday premarket trading after Benzinga reported that the Michael biopic opened to a record $217 million global box office over the weekend. The data remains unverified, but the size of the opening could signal a mid-cap media rally if corroborated, shaping investor expectations for content slate and profitability.

Key Takeaways

  • Lionsgate stock is up ~9.36% in Monday premarket trading.
  • The Michael biopic reportedly opened to $217 million global box office.
  • Production costs reportedly rose to near $200 million due to reshoots.
  • Lionsgate reportedly sold international distribution rights to Universal Studios to recoup costs.

MarketMoodz Analysis

The premarket move highlights how a single title can meaningfully move a mid-cap media stock, particularly if box office strength translates into improved profitability and debt management. If the opening proves durable, it could justify a re-rating of Lionsgate’s earnings power and cash flow visibility amid ongoing content-cost pressures.

Historically, blockbuster openings provide temporary lift to studio stocks, but sustained upside depends on follow-on performance across international markets, streaming monetization, and cost discipline. Investors should watch for corroborating box office data, production-cost disclosures, and guidance updates from Lionsgate and peers like Disney, Comcast, and Netflix as the industry navigates a post-pandemic cinema recovery and the evolving streaming landscape.
